The Magnum Ice Cream Co. announced fiscal year 2025 earnings came in at $9.38 million, +4.2% organic sales growth (OSG) year-on-year, with volume growth +1.5% and price growth +2.6%. Operating Profit was $711 million driven by four leading brands, Magnum, Ben & Jerry’s, Cornetto and the Heartbrand along with 150 new launches, reported CEO Peter Ter Kulve. In 2026, the company expects 3% to 5% organic sales growth.

Jeff Mroz and his wife Kathryn Moos, co-founded Bozeman, Mont.-based Pioneer Pastures to help reshape the future of food by prioritizing gut health, accessible nutrition and dairy innovation. Drawing on his success building OWYN (Only What You Need) into a nationally recognized protein brand, Mroz discusses why they’re using ultra-filtered milk from cows with the A2 gene the growth in A2 milk and Pioneer Pastures’ founding in 2024.

The nonprofit RAND reports that GLP-1 drugs are the No. 1 health and nutrition trend in 2026. Diet recommendations focus on protein and fiber for users of these products to counteract muscle loss and gastrointestinal side effects. This fact bodes well for dairy products such as cottage cheese and yogurt as the nutrition of dairy products is needed to make up for the insufficient nutrients that are lacking for consumers taking these weight loss drugs.
